Navigating New Jersey's Telemarketing Laws: A Comprehensive Overview
Navigating New Jersey’s Telemarketing Laws requires a thorough understanding of regulations specific to autodialers. With advancements in technology, businesses increasingly rely on automated calling systems, known as autodialers, to reach potential customers. However, this practice raises concerns about consumer privacy and protection, leading to stringent legal frameworks. The state of New Jersey has implemented comprehensive laws to govern telemarketing practices, ensuring fair and ethical business conduct.
An autodialer lawyer in New Jersey must be well-versed in these regulations to guide businesses effectively. Key aspects include obtaining prior express consent from recipients before making automated calls, providing a clear and concise opt-out mechanism, and adhering to restrictions on the timing of calls. Non-compliance can result in substantial fines, damaging business reputation. The Role of an Autodialer Attorney in Ensuring Compliance
In the complex landscape of telecommunications regulations, an autodialer attorney in New Jersey plays a pivotal role in ensuring compliance for businesses utilizing automated dialing systems. These legal experts navigate the intricate web of laws and guidelines governing autodialers, such as those outlined by the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A) and state-specific regulations like the New Jersey Telephone Consumer Protection Act. Their expertise is crucial in helping companies avoid costly mistakes and potential fines associated with non-compliance.
An autodialer lawyer in New Jersey assists clients in understanding their legal obligations, designing compliance strategies, and drafting policies to safeguard against unlawful practices. They guide businesses through obtaining necessary permissions from callers, ensuring proper disclosure of automated messages, and implementing do-not-call mechanisms. Moreover, these attorneys offer invaluable advice on best practices for data management, record-keeping, and reporting to maintain transparency and adherence to legal requirements.
